Akerman Rivers Quads to Score a Double Bust Out

Level 4 : Blinds 200/400, 400 ante
Ariel Akerman
Ariel Akerman

The action was caught with 19,500 in the middle with three players looking at a board of 6A4A.

Both the blinds checked the action to the hijack, who moved all in for 12,800. The small blind snap-called the bet their last 7,500 and Ariel Akerman, in the big blind, also called to have them both at risk.

Small Blind: 44 All in
Hijack: K9 All in
Ariel Akerman: AQ

Akerman's trips were behind the full house of the small blind, however, the A river improved him to quads to score a double Bust Out

Sood Scores Consecutive KO's

Level 3 : Blinds 200/300, 300 ante

On a heads-up completed board of 26948, a player led for 6,000 but then Gaurav Sood moved all in to cover him. After some thought, the player shrugged, made the call to put himself at risk, and tabled 103 for a turned flush. Unfortunately for him, Sood rolled over AK for the nut flush to take the pot, eliminating his opponent.

The very next hand, Sood opened to 500 and was called by the big blind to see the flop of 964. The small blind then led for 1,300 and Sood just called to see the 7 appear on the turn. The big blind checked, Sood bet 3,000, and the small blind quickly called.

On the river 8, both players got it all in, with Sood covering.

Big blind: 45All in
Gaurav Sood: 910

Both players had made a straight on the river, but Sood's was superior to claim the pot, and he once again eliminated his opponent.

Peters Rivers a Full House to Crack His Opponents Flush

Level 2 : Blinds 100/200, 200 ante

The action was caught with approximately 19,000 in the middle with two players looking at a board of 8384.

The under-the-gun player checked the action to Paul Peters, in middle position, who bet out 6,500. The player under the gun check-raised, moving all in for their effective stack of 17,400, and Peters called.

Under the Gun: 97 All in
Paul Peters: AA

Peters' opponent had already made a flush, but Peters had a redraw to a higher flush and full house outs. The 8 on the river filled up Peters, and his opponent was sent to the rail.

Kublnick Coolers His Opponent

Level 1 : Blinds 100/100, 100 ante

The pot had already grown to 10,900 with two players heading to a flop of 264.

Joshua Kublnick, in early position, checked the action to his opponent in middle position. They bet out 5,000 and Kublnick responded with a check raise, moving all in for their effective stack of 14,500. After a considerable amount of time in the tank, the player in middle position called.

Middle Position: QQ All in
Joshua Kublnick: KK

This cooler fell in Kublnick's favour as the 8 turn and 8 river changed nothing, sending this big pot to Kublnick.

Tanita Scores Knockout in Level One

Level 1 : Blinds 100/100, 100 ante

On a three-way completed board of 4QJ210, the pot had around 12,500 in it when the small blind checked to the early positioned player, who decided to move all in for 10,600.

The action was then on Robert Tanita in the hijack who tanked for close to a minute before he decided to make the call, followed by a quick fold from the small blind.

"Tens and fours," The at-risk player announced as he tabled 104 for a rivered two pair, but Tanita had him beat as he tabled J10 for a bigger two pair.

Tanita was then pushed then pot and he took a satisfying pull from his pineapple mimosa as his opponent headed to the exit.

Curcio Sends Opponent to an Early Exit

Level 1 : Blinds 100/100, 100 ante
Joseph Curcio
Joseph Curcio

Joseph Curcio rasied to 400 from the hijack, receiving calls from both the cutoff and the button. The small blind squeezed to 2,400 and all three players called.

The 647 flop slowed down the small blind with a check. Curcio took the lead for 6,500 and the cutoff moved all in for 17,000 in a snap. The button and small blind folded, while Curcio called.

Cutoff: AJ All in
Joseph Curcio: 76

The 2 turn and Q river failed to improve the cutoff's flush draw, allowing Curcio's two pair to send him to the rail.
